Denmark Faces Nationwide Telecom and Rail Disruptions

Widespread mobile network outages and halted train services leave thousands affected, with emergency services deploying alternative measures.

Overview

  • The mobile network of Denmark's largest telecom provider, TDC, has suffered a major outage, affecting users across the country, including emergency number 112.
  • Danish police and emergency services have increased their presence on the streets to provide alternative contact points for those needing urgent assistance.
  • Rail services across multiple routes in western Denmark were halted due to a failure in the digital signaling system, leaving some trains stranded mid-journey.
  • Authorities are investigating the causes of the disruptions, with TDC suggesting a recent system update as a possible factor, while ruling out evidence of a cyberattack so far.
  • Train operations on affected routes are gradually resuming, with Banedanmark working with suppliers to address the issues and restore full service in the coming days.
